If you have standard Minor front hubs then it is near impossible to alter the pcd from 4" (Minor) to 3.75" (Marina) as there is not enough metal to do the job properly.
Better to find a S/H set of Marina front hubs and fit them using the top hat spacer kit.

I am very surprised that you cannot find the correct Mr Grumpy' disc brake conversion bearings to allow for the fitting of standard Marina front hubs to Minor front stub axles.

The inner bearing is Timkin L44649 which is the same as a classic Mini rear hub bearing
The outer bearing is SKF 30203J2.

Both bearings are readily available on 'e' bay.
